If you're planning to immigrate and need a medical exam to comply with U.S. citizenship requirements, finding a qualified physician in your area is crucial. These exams are necessary by the government to ensure that immigrants don't pose any health threats to the public. A comprehensive medical exam typically includes a physical assessment, bloodwork, and screening for infectious diseases.

To find an authorized civil surgeon near you, you can use resources like the U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S) website or contact your local clinic. It's important to ensure the physician is certified with USCIS to perform these exams, as they are mandatory for a successful application process.

Arrange an appointment well in advance, as there may be a waiting list due to high demand. Be prepared to provide your visa documents and personal information. During the exam, be honest and forthright with the physician about your medical history.

  • Keep in mind that accurate and full medical information is essential for your immigration application.
  • Gather all necessary documents beforehand to streamline the process.
  • Communicate openly with the physician about any questions or concerns you may have.
